I have connected my bank account but not all of my employment history is verified

Updated over 2 weeks ago

If you find that your bank account only covers part of your employment history, this may be due to:

  • Your bank’s data sharing policy: Some banks (e.g., Barclays, Nationwide, Santander) only report the last two years of transactions, meaning employment history before this time can not be verified.

  • You haven’t connected all your accounts: You may have only been paid into the account you connected for a certain period, and not for the full employment history requested for verification.

To complete your verification, try connecting any other bank accounts you were paid into during your employment. If no additional accounts are available, you can instead move on from the banking section and continue to connect other data sources (e.g. HMRC, payroll) to complete your verification.
